Who won the fastest skater 2021?

Kyrou (13.550 seconds) was the surprise winner of the skating race, edging Los Angeles' Adrian Kempe (13.585) in the lively one-lap competition among eight skaters. Perhaps more impressively, Kyrou, Kempe and the Rangers' Chris Kreider all beat Connor McDavid, the three-time winner of the title.

Did McDavid win fastest skater?

New York Islanders center Mathew Barzal bested him in the 2020 race, finishing with a time of 13.175 seconds to McDavid's 13.215 seconds.

Who is the fastest ice hockey player?

The fastest hockey players reach top speeds of approximately 25mp/h or 40km/h. While in game action they would play in the range of 20 to 25mph to 30 to 40km/h. Connor McDavid of the Edmonton Oilers is acknowledged as the fastest skater in the NHL.

Who won the All-Star game NHL 2022?

The Metropolitan Division came away with a 5-3 win over the Central Division in the finals. For the third time in six years, the Metropolitan Division won the NHL All-Star Game. Behind two goals from Claude Giroux in the championship game, the Metropolitan Division defeated the Central Division 5-3 in Las Vegas to win.

How fast did Dylan Larkin skate?

Larkin won the 2016 competition at Bridgestone Arena in Nashville with a time of 13.172 seconds, eclipsing the mark of 13.386 seconds established by Mike Gartner in 1996.
